As guests arrived at the Omni Tuesday afternoon to check in, they were greeted by General Manager Paul Eckert who explained, “Martinis to your right, champagne to your left.”

It was an unusually festive atmosphere as Downtown’s four-diamond hotel joined the other 44 Omni hotels and resorts to celebrate the 21st anniversary of the Select Guest rewards program.

“We’re the first brand in the industry with a program that isn’t points-driven,” said Eckert. “Stay at an Omni for 10 nights and you earn a free night at any Omni hotel or resort.”

Director of Sales and Marketing Dave Disalvo said Select Guest members account for 28 percent of all Omni check-ins on average, but at the Jacksonville property it’s not uncommon for up to 70 percent of the guests on any given night to be participants in the program. The benefits include free pressing, shoe shines, wireless Internet, morning newspapers and coffee delivered to the room.

“It’s an instant reward and very personalized service,” he added. “Who wants to be away from home traveling on business? We make the experience as pleasant as possible.”

The Omni will celebrate another milestone Oct. 27 when the hotel will mark its 23rd anniversary Downtown.
